About Marie-Laure Potet

Marie-Laure Potet is a scholar working on Software, Signal Processing and Artificial Intelligence, having authored 15 papers that have together received 115 indexed citations. Recurring topics across this work include Advanced Malware Detection Techniques (8 papers), Security and Verification in Computing (7 papers) and Software Testing and Debugging Techniques (5 papers). The work is most often cited by research in Software (52 citations), Signal Processing (56 citations) and Artificial Intelligence (70 citations). Marie-Laure Potet has collaborated with scholars based in France and India. Frequent co-authors include Laurent Mounier, Josselin Feist, Roland Groz, Jean‐Marie Flaus, Lydie du Bousquet, Olivier Maury, Catherine Oriat, Yves Ledru, Daniel Le Métayer and Valérie Viêt Triêm Tông. Their work appears in journals such as Communications of the ACM, Computers & Security and Journal of Computer Virology and Hacking Techniques.
